Harimogu Harley (TV)

Alternative title:
Harley Spiny
はりもぐハーリー (Japanese)
Genres: slice of life
Plot Summary: In a part of the world lies the Village of Animals. Living within the village is the hedgehog, Harry, a small yet mischievious child. His classmates include the elephant, the crocodile and the squirrel. They play and do things together, days filled with fun and joy. Surrounding them are adults with unique personalities, such as the mother who takes pride in providing the best education for her children, the artisan-spirited father and the conscientious teachers. This is a story that revolves around familiar themes in life such as school and family, and will surely relate to everyone.
Running time: 10 minutes per episode
Number of episodes: 140
Episode titles: We have 140
Vintage: 1996-08-05 to 1997-06-27
